About BioCell Analytica
BioCell Analytica utför biologiska analyser för att upptäcka hälsofarliga kemikalier i vatten. Det unika med våra metoder är att de mäter effekten av alla hälsoskadliga ämnen i ett prov, istället för att som tidigare mäta halten av ett fåtal utvalda kemiska ämnen. Detta ger värdefull information som kan hjälpa oss att förstå hur människors hälsa och miljön påverkas av alla kemikalier vi utsätts för samtidigt, den så kallade cocktaileffekten. Metoderna är resultatet av forskning vid Sveriges lantbruksuniversitet. Biocell Analytica erbjuder analysmetoder för att upptäcka kemiska föroreningar i miljön, t.ex. i dricksvatten, avloppsvatten, ytvatten, jord, sediment och livsmedel. ___________________________________________________ BioCell Analytica offers effect-based methods to detect hazardous compounds in water and solid matrices. The great strength with effect-based methods is the possibility to detect and quantify effects of all hazardous compounds in a sample, instead of focusing on concentrations of a few selected compounds, which is done with chemical analyses. The generated knowledge contributes to our understanding of how human health and the environment are affected by all the chemicals we are exposed to simultaneously, the so-called cocktail effect. This new strategy to monitor chemical hazards in water has been developed and applied in multiple research projects, where we have collaborated with drinking water and wastewater treatment plants. BioCell Analytica’s methods can be used to detect chemical contaminants in the environment, e.g. in drinking water, wastewater, surface water, storm water, sludge, sediment and soil.
